Introduction. Goitre with euthyroid function or with subclinical or mild hyperthyroidism due to thyroid autonomy is common. In anthroposophic medicine various thyroid disorders are treated withColchicum autumnale(CAU). We examined the effects of CAU in patients with goitre of both functional states.Patients and methods. In an observational study, 24 patients with goitre having suppressed thyroid stimulating hormone (TSH) levels with normal or slightly elevated free thyroxine (fT4) and free triiodothyronine (fT3) (group 1,n=12) or normal TSH, fT3, and fT4 (group 2,n=12) were included. After 3 months and after 6 to 12 months of CAU treatment, we investigated clinical pathology using the Hyperthyroid Symptom Scale (HSS), hormone status (TSH, fT4, and fT3), and thyroidal volume (tV).Results. After treatment with CAU, in group 1 the median HSS decreased from 4.5 (2.3–11.8) to 2 (1.3–3) (p<0.01) and fT3 decreased from 3.85 (3.5–4.78) to 3.45 (3.3–3.78) pg/mL (p<0.05). In group 2 tV (13.9% (18.5%–6.1%)) and TSH (p<0.01) were reduced. Linear regression for TSH and fT3 in both groups indicated a regulative therapeutic effect of CAU.Conclusions. CAU positively changed the clinical pathology of subclinical hyperthyroidism and thyroidal volume in patients with euthyroid goitre by normalization of the regulation of thyroidal hormones.

The primary aim of this study was to compare the prevalence of subclinical hypothyroidism (SCH) using two different cut-off levels for TSH values (≥2.5 mIU/L versus ≥4.1 mIU/L). The secondary objective was to analyze the clinical-biochemical characteristics in women with and without SCH. This was a retrospective cross-sectional study. In total, 1496 Mexican women with infertility were included: Group 1, women with TSH levels ranging between 0.3 and 2.49 mIU/L, n = 886; Group 2, women with TSH between 2.5 and 4.09 mIU/L, n = 390; and Group 3, women with TSH ≥4.1 mIU/L n = 220. SCH prevalence was 40.7% (CI 95%: 38.3–43.3%) with TSH cut-off ≥ 2.5 mIU/L, and 14.7% (CI 95%: 12.7–16.5%) with TSH cut-off ≥ 4.1 mIU/L, (p = 0.0001). The prevalence of overweight was higher in Group 2 than in Groups 1 and 3. Thyroid autoimmunity, obesity and insulin resistance were higher in Group 3 than in Group 1 (p < 0.05). No other differences were observed between groups. Conclusions: The prevalence of SCH in our selected patients increased almost three times using a TSH cut-off ≥ 2.5 mIU/L compared with a TSH cut-off ≥ 4.1 mIU/L. Women with TSH ≥4.1 mIU/L compared with TSH cut-off ≤ 2.5 mIU/L more often presented with obesity, thyroid autoimmunity and insulin resistance.

Abstract Objectives Non-alcoholic fatty liver disease (NAFLD) is a common obesity-related comorbidity in childhood. In this study, we aimed to evaluate predictors of NAFLD by comparing clinical, endocrine and metabolic findings in obese children with and without hepatosteatosis. Methods Two hundred and eight obese children aged 6–18 years were included. The patients were divided into group 1 (patients with NAFLD, n=94) and group 2 (patients without NAFLD, n=114). Anthropometric measurements, pubertal stage, lipid profiles, fasting glucose and insulin, homeostatic model of assessment for insulin resistance (HOMA-IR), uric acid, total bilirubin, alanine aminotransferase (ALT), blood urea nitrogen, thyroid-stimulating hormone and free thyroxine parameters were compared retrospectively. Results The mean body weight, body mass index (BMI), height, tri-ponderal mass index (TMI), insulin, HOMA-IR, triglyceride, ALT and uric acid values were significantly higher, while high-density lipoprotein-cholesterol (HDL-C) values were significantly lower in group 1. The 70.7% of obese children with hepatosteatosis and 83.9% of those without hepatosteatosis were correctly estimated by parameters including age, gender, ALT, HDL-C, fasting insulin and uric acid values. Conclusions Since obesity-associated hepatosteatosis induces various long-term metabolic impacts in children, early detection is of critical importance. Age, gender, TMI, BMI, ALT, HDL-C, fasting insulin and uric acid values may help to predict the risk of hepatosteatosis. Besides, we assessed whether TMI compared to BMI does not have a better utility in estimating obesity-induced hepatosteatosis in children. This is the first study to show the association between TMI and hepatosteatosis in children.

AbstractObjective. Interleukin-35 (IL-35), an interleukin-12 (IL-12) cytokine family member, is shown to be a potent immunosuppressive and anti-inflammatory cytokine. Inducible regulatory T cells (Tregs) produce IL-35 that mediates the immune inhibitory function of Tregs. Growing evidence revealed that upregulation of IL-35 expression may play a critical role in the prevention of autoimmune diseases in various experimental autoimmunity models and vice versa. Hashimoto’s thyroiditis (HT) is considered to be a Treg cell-related autoimmune disease with loss of self-tolerance. Methods. One hundred-twenty eight subjects, newly diagnosed hypothyroid HT patients [56 overt (Group 1), 72 subclinical hypothyroid (Group 2)] and 38 healthy controls (Group 3) were enrolled in the study. The levels of serum IL-35 were determined by enzyme-linked immunosorbent assay (ELISA). Results. Serum IL-35 levels were lower in the HT group when compared with subclinical HT group [304.5 (834.6) pg/ml vs. 636.1 (1542.0) pg/ml, p=0.004] and control cases [304.5 (834.6) pg/ml vs. 1064.7 (2526.8) pg/ml, p<0.001]. Serum IL-35 levels were inversely associated with thyroid stimulating hormone (TSH; rs=-0.396, p<0.001) and anti-thyroid peroxidase antibodies (TPOAb; rs=-0.571, p<0.001) in whole group. Serum IL-35 were negatively associated with TSH (rs=-0.264, p=0.003) and TPOAb (rs=-0.735, p<0.001) in patients with Hashimoto’s thyroiditis (Group 1 + Group 2). Conclusion. The results suggest that IL-35 may play a role in the pathogenesis of HT.

Objectives: To study the correlation between recovery time and hemoglobin level in COVID-19 infected patients. Study Design: Observational study. Setting: Rawal Institute of Health Sciences Islamabad, Pakistan Institute of Medical Sciences Islamabad. Period: February 2021 to June 2021. Material & Methods: Data was analyzed using SPSS version 27.Mann Whitney U test was used to compare the duration of recovery among the groups and spearman's correlation was applied for correlating the duration of recovery with the Hb levels of COVID-19 patients. Result: Group 1 patients recovered within 14 days and group 2 patients recovered after 14 days. COVID-19 infected Patients with low hemoglobin level took more than 14-20 days to recover from disease and those with high hemoglobin recovered within 8-14 days. Conclusion. Recovery from disease was prolonged in corona virus infected patients with less hemoglobin as compared to patients with high levels of hemoglobin levels.

Aims: Aim of this investigation was to access the association of dyslipidemia with subclinical hypothyroidism. Methodology: In this cross-sectional investigation, 1948 participants were recruited. Two groups were made; participants up to 18 years were in group A and Subjects over 18 years were incorporated in group 2. They were subdivided into control, subclinical hypothyroid 1, and subclinical hypothyroid 2. SPSS 21 was used for data analysis. Results:  Data of 1619 individuals were analyzed. The mean age of Group A participants was 12.79 ± 2.779, and the mean age of Group B participants was 42.58 ± 18.012. The prevalence of subclinical hypothyroid was found at 13.5 %. Significant differences have been observed while comparing Group A and Group B (P <0.001). Free tetraiodothyronine and Free triiodothyronine also showed a significant difference in both groups. (P<0.05). No significant difference between mean Thyroid-stimulating hormone levels was observed (P>0.05). No significant association between Controls and High-density Lipid values was found between Controls and subclinical hypothyroid. Conclusion: We conclude that subclinical hypothyroidism leads to increased dyslipidemia. Lower Serum total cholesterol and low-density lipid levels were detected among children and participants under the age of 18 with Thyroid-stimulating hormone greater than 10 mIU/L. Thyroid-stimulating hormone less than 10.0 mIU/L had no lipid abnormalities in subclinical hypothyroid participants.

PurposeCOVID-19 (Coronavirus Disease 2019) was first reported in December 2019 and quickly swept across China and around the world. Levels of anxiety and depression were increased among pregnant women during this infectious pandemic. Thyroid function is altered during stressful experiences, and any abnormality during early pregnancy may significantly affect fetal development and pregnancy outcomes. This study aimed to determine whether the COVID-19 pandemic induces thyroid hormone changes in early pregnant women.MethodsThis study comprised two groups of pregnant women in Shanghai in their first trimester – those pregnant women before the COVID-19 outbreak from January 20, 2019, to March 31, 2019 (Group 1) and those pregnant during the COVID-19 outbreak from January 20, 2020, to March 31, 2020 (Group 2). All women were included if they had early pregnancy thyrotropin (TSH), free triiodothyronine (FT3), free thyroxine (FT4), total triiodothyronine (TT3), and total thyroxine (TT4) concentrations, thyroid peroxidase (TPO) antibody or thyroglobulin antibody (TgAb) available and did not have a history of thyroid diseases or received thyroid treatment before or during pregnancy. We used propensity score matching to form a cohort in which patients had similar baseline characteristics.ResultsAmong 3338 eligible pregnant women, 727 women in Group 1 and 727 in Group 2 had similar propensity scores and were included in the analyses. Pregnant women in Group 2 had significantly higher FT3 (5.7 vs. 5.2 pmol/L, P&lt;0.001) and lower FT4 (12.8 vs. 13.2 pmol/L, P&lt;0.001) concentrations compared with those in Group 1. Pregnant women in Group 2 were more likely to develop isolated hypothyroxinemia (11.6% vs. 6.9%, OR, 1.75 [95% CI, 1.20–2.53], P=0.003) than those in Group 1 but had a significantly lower risk of TgAb positivity (12.0% vs. 19.0%, OR, 0.58 [95% CI, 0.43–0.78], P&lt;0.001).ConclusionPregnant women in their first trimester in Shanghai during the COVID-19 outbreak were at an increased risk of having higher FT3 concentrations, lower FT4 concentrations, and isolated hypothyroxinemia. The association between thyroid hormones, pregnancy outcomes, and the COVID-19 outbreak should be explored further.

Abstract Background The dacryoendoscope is the only instrument that can observe the luminal side of the lacrimal passage with minimal invasiveness. It was developed to treat lacrimal passage obstructions by inserting a bicanalicular nasal stent with sheath-guided bicanalicular intubation (SG-BCI). The purpose of this study was to determine the outcomes of SG-BCI to treat lacrimal passage obstructions. In addition, to determine the effects of SG-BCI treatment on the quality of life. Methods This was a retrospective observational study of 128 patients (mean age 70.9 ± 11.0 years, range 28–93 years) diagnosed with a unilateral lacrimal passage obstruction. There were 73 patients with a nasolacrimal duct obstruction, 37 with a lacrimal canaliculus obstruction, 7 with a lacrimal punctum obstruction, and 11 with common lacrimal canaliculus and nasolacrimal duct obstructions. They were all treated with SG-BCI. The postoperative subjective outcomes were assessed by the answers to the Glasgow Benefit Inventory (GBI) questionnaire and to an ocular specific questionnaire on 6 symptoms including tearing, ocular discharges, swelling, pain, irritation, and blurred vision. The objective assessments were the surgical success rates and the patency at 6 months after the bicanalicular nasal stent was removed. The patients were divided into those with a pre-saccal obstruction, Group 1, and with a post-saccal obstruction, Group 2. The subjective and objective outcomes were compared between the two groups. Results One hundred twenty-four sides (96.9%) had a successful probing and intubation of the lacrimal passage obstruction by SG-BCI. Of the 124 sides, 110 sides (88.7%) retained the patency after the stent was removed for at least 6 months. The GBI total, general subscale, social support, and physical health scores were + 37.1 ± 29.0, + 41.5 ± 30.0, + 28.0 ± 39.4, and + 24.1 ± 37.7, respectively, postoperatively. All of the 6 ocular specific symptom scores improved significantly postoperatively. The postoperative score of tearing improved in Group 1 (P < 0.0001), while the postoperative scores of all symptoms improved significantly in Group 2. Conclusions The relatively high surgical success rates and positive GBI scores, and improved ocular symptom scores indicate that SG-BCI is a good minimally invasive method to treat lacrimal passage obstructions.

BACKGROUND: Inflammation has an important role in the pathogenesis of atherosclerosis. Lymphocyte-to-monocyte ratio (LMR) is accepted as an indicator of inflammation. OBJECTIVE: Our aim was to scrutinize the relationship between LMR and subclinical atherosclerosis (SubAth) measured by carotid intima-media thickness (CIMT) in subclinical hypothyroidism (SubHT). METHODS: Newly identified 190 SubHT patients were prospectively included into the study. Blood samples were taken for measuring laboratory parameters. Then, CIMT was computed. Patients were seperated into 2 groups by their CIMT value (Group-1: ≤0.9 and Group-2: >0.9 mm), and then stratified into tertiles pursuant to LMR and thyroid-stimulating hormone (TSH) levels, respectively. RESULTS: 59 patients had an increased CIMT value (Group-2), and 131 patients had a normal CIMT value (Group-1). Group-2 had a lower LMR and a greater high-sensitivity C-reactive protein (hsCRP), CIMT and TSH than Group-1 (for all, p <  0.05). Patients in the lowest tertile of LMR had a higher hsCRP, TSH and CIMT than those in the highest tertile (for all, p <  0.05). LMR was negatively associated with hsCRP, CIMT and TSH (for all, p <  0.05). LMR and TSH were independent predictors of increased CIMT. CONCLUSIONS: Pre-ultrasonographic LMR, which is a simple and inexpensive inflammatory marker, may give additional predictive information to determine SubAth in SubHT.

Abstract Background: We hypothesized that the recommended incretin-mimetic therapy associates with a better outcome (1-year mortality after discharge, rehospitalizations within 12 months) and with less hypoglycemic events in type − 2 diabetics following myocardial revascularization. Methods: Hospitalized type-2 diabetics of the Departments of Cardiology and Cardiothoracic Surgery (University Hospital Halle), who had percutaneous coronary intervention (29.4%) or coronary artery bypass graft (70.6%) in 2016, were included in this observational study: Group 1 (incretin-mimetic therapy), Group 2 (insulin therapy without incretin mimetics) or Group 3 (oral diabetes medication without incretins or insulin). They were asked to mail in a questionnaire on medical therapy, number of hypoglycemic episodes and rehospitalizations 2 years following discharge. In non-responders, the vital status was obtained by local registries 2.4 years after discharge. Results: 204 patients were recruited in this prospective observational study. At discharge, only 3.9% of all type-2 diabetics had an incretin mimetic, 39.7% were on insulin, and 56.4% on oral medication. In all patient groups together, the prevalence of incretin-mimetic therapy did not change (3.9% at discharge, 2.9% at follow-up). The prevalence of sodium glucose transporter-2–inhibitor therapy slightly increased from 6.8% at discharge to 9.2% at follow-up. However, 85 out of 173 patients (49.1%) did not provide follow-up questionnaires. In hospital mortality (Group 1: 0%, Group 2: 0%, Group 3: 5.2%; p = 0.092), 1-year mortality after discharge ( Group 1: 12.5%, Group 2: 13.6%, Group 3: 11.9%; p = 0.944), and number of rehospitalizations within 12 months after discharge (Group 1: 1.0 per capita, Group 2: 1.0, Group 3: 1.1; p = 0.697) were similar among groups. Hypoglycemic events 6 months prior to follow-up were highest in Group 2 (0.9 ± 2.3) in comparison to Group 1 (0 ± 0) and Group 3 (0.1 ± 0.3; p = 0.017). Conclusion: Even after adjusting for surviving patients not sending back questionnaires, the adherence to the recommendations regarding incretin-mimetic and sodium-glucose transporter-2–inhibitor therapy was poor. With the limitation of a low patient number, both 1-year mortality after discharge and rehospitalizations were similar among groups. Self-reported hypoglycemic events occurred more often in insulin-treated diabetics than in the ones without.

Abstract Background Currently, the management of SARS-CoV-2 varies with no definitive clinical guidelines, as scientific evidence across the globe differs in therapeutic options. This study intends to provide some clarity to the insufficient data based on the role of monotherapy with tocilizumab (TCZ) and combination therapy with remdesivir (RDV) and TCZ among patients in El Paso, Texas. Methods 154 SARS-CoV-2-positive patients from four different hospitals in El Paso, Texas, were screened, with 113 eligible for this longitudinal comparative observational study (2/1/2020-10/31/2020). Group 1 (80 patients) were given TCZ within the first 24 hours of hospitalization, followed by methylprednisolone for 72 hours, and Group 2 (33 patients) received TCZ as detailed in the single therapy group, plus RDV within the first 24 hours. Mann Whitney U test assessed Median differences in laboratory biomarkers and Bivariate Logistic Regression assessed the odds of risk. An observation is said to be statistically significant if P-value is ≤ 0.05. Results A statistically significant increased median IL-6 values were noted among those given only TCZ compared to those that received TCZ plus RDV (511.33 vs. 199.0) with a P-value (0.007). Patients in Group 1 had statistically significant lower odds for ventilation use than Group 2 (OR=0.34, 95%CI=0.12-0.95, p=0.034), although no statistically significant difference in mortality outcomes was observed across groups (OR=0.43, 95%CI:0.13-1.39, p=0.269). Table 1. Laboratory biomarkers and treatment groups (Mann Whitney U test) Table 2. Clinical outcomes and treatment groups using the Bivariate Logistic regression (OR) Conclusion This study population is unique as it reflects a predominantly Hispanic demographic population in El Paso with different genetics, background characteristics, and predisposition to diabetes, and obesity than the rest of the United States (US). We concluded that the use of TCZ in SARS-CoV-2 positive patients in El Paso, with or without RDV, reported no mortality benefit. However, some minimal/non-use of ventilation benefit was observed in Group 1. Our study design is considered the first of its kind using TCZ and RDV in a longitudinal comparative observational study. Nonetheless, a randomized controlled trial study is recommended to ultimately determine the combination role of TCZ and RDV among this highly vulnerable group of patients.
